diff options
author | tof <> | 2008-06-03 14:33:23 +0000 |
---|---|---|
committer | tof <> | 2008-06-03 14:33:23 +0000 |
commit | fc7a265444190876cf18e83d1ce89c8e71ec237f (patch) | |
tree | b68893c877c1903c73beb6045929b16a4f3702a3 | |
parent | 9868f4ec0609bcdf4684df97b8ada90b838807df (diff) |
Fixed #860
-rw-r--r-- | HISTORY | 1 | ||||
-rw-r--r-- | framework/PradoBase.php | 12 |
2 files changed, 7 insertions, 6 deletions
@@ -5,6 +5,7 @@ BUG: Ticket#841 - Strange output from THttpResponse (Christophe) BUG: Ticket#847 - getBaseUrl sometimes fails (Christophe) BUG: Ticket#843 - TDataList alternatinItem issue after changes in rev 2227 (Christophe) BUG: Ticket#849 - TDatePicker selecting current date problem (Christophe) +BUG: Ticket#860 - Prado::localize() bug (japplegame) ENH: Added Prado.Validation.validateControl(id) on client side to validate a specific control (Michael) Version 3.1.2 April 21, 2008 diff --git a/framework/PradoBase.php b/framework/PradoBase.php index d9e9444e..2fba2ffd 100644 --- a/framework/PradoBase.php +++ b/framework/PradoBase.php @@ -571,11 +571,11 @@ class PradoBase //no translation handler provided
if($app===null || ($config = $app->getTranslationConfiguration())===null)
return strtr($text, $params);
-
- Translation::init();
-
- if(empty($catalogue) && isset($config['catalogue']))
- $catalogue = $config['catalogue'];
+ + if ($catalogue===null) + $catalogue=isset($config['catalogue'])?$config['catalogue']:'messages'; +
+ Translation::init($catalogue);
//globalization charset
$appCharset = $app===null ? '' : $app->getCharset();
@@ -587,7 +587,7 @@ class PradoBase if(empty($charset)) $charset = $appCharset;
if(empty($charset)) $charset = $defaultCharset;
- return Translation::formatter()->format($text,$params,$catalogue,$charset);
+ return Translation::formatter($catalogue)->format($text,$params,$catalogue,$charset);
}
}
|